Buckingham Palace, United Kingdom (828,800 square feet):
Buckingham Palace is the world’s second-largest residence for the royal family of London and an administrative center. This home is huge in square footage, clocking in at a whopping 828,800. It has 775 rooms, a post office, a cinema, a swimming pool, a doctor’s surgery room, a jeweler’s workshop, and London’s most extensive private garden. Meadow Brook Hall is another of the world’s biggest mansions that is also a rather typical construction. It was designed using a Tudor Revival architectural style by William Kapp, and it was built at the behest of Matilda Dodge Wilson, who was the heiress of the Dodge car company. However, in recent years, it is no longer a private residence and has instead been turned into a historic house museum.
